The two were high school sweethearts who fell in love at the age of 13. After high school they both attended Ohio University and often made the drive from their hometown near Pittsburgh while singing Shania Twain’s song “From This Moment On,” which they knew would one day be their wedding song.
On September 23, 2017 the tune did become their wedding song accompanying many cherished recollections that were carefully woven into the wedding and reception at the hotel. Bonnie Walker of Bonnie Walker Events planned the wedding saying, “We had to incorporate the many memories and years of love that they have for each other in their wedding.”The couple chose the Hotelitist Hotel after falling in love with its elegant features and astonishing details. It was the perfect place to celebrate with 290 weddings guests, including a wedding party of 20. “My vision for the wedding was very elegant and romantic with lots of flowers and candles everywhere,” Meaghan says. “I had seen Bonnie’s work before, so I knew I was in great hands.”Walker introduced a color scheme including ivories, golds and varying florals for an extraordinary level of elegance and romance. Her attention to detail was perfect for the couple whose engagement was also carefully coordinated. Mitchol surprised Meaghan with a marriage proposal in Paris when she was visiting the city with her family.“[The photographer] had me turn around and face the Eiffel Tower for a picture, and when I turned back around, Mitchol was there on one knee,” Meaghan remembers. “I was in complete shock and instantly started crying. It was the most amazing moment of my life.”
